Bring water and margarine to a boil in a saucepan; stir in stuffing mix. Cover and remove from heat. Let stand until stuffing is softened, about 5 minutes. Fluff with a fork. Spoon about 1/2 cup stuffing over each slice of turkey. Roll turkey around stuffing and arrange rolls in a microwave-safe dish, seam-side down. Pour gravy over rolls.

Instructions. Preheat oven to 350°F. Lay out 2 slices of turkey overlapping them slightly. Place stuffing mix on one end and roll up tightly. Repeat with remaining turkey. Place seam side down in a 9x13 pan. Pour gravy over top of turkey rolls. Add frozen green beans, salt, pepper and butter to the side of the pan.

Directions. Prepare stuffing mix according to package directions. Meanwhile, in a small bowl, combine soup and milk; set aside. Spoon about 1/4 cup stuffing onto each turkey slice. Roll up and place in a greased 13-in. x 9-in. baking dish. Pour soup mixture over roll-ups.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 20 minutes. Sprinkle with onions.

To make turkey roll-ups with stove top stuffing, prepare the stuffing mix according to the package instructions. Lay out the turkey slices flat on a cutting board and spread a layer of stuffing on each slice. Roll up the turkey slices tightly and secure with a toothpick if needed. Place the rolls in a baking dish and pour gravy over the top.

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Lay down two slices of turkey over lapping them about about 1/3. Place about 1/3 a cup of the stuffing at the end of one slice and roll up. Continue this until you have all 8 rollups complete. Place in a 9 x 13 baking dish. Cover rolls with half of the prepared gravy. Cover with foil and bake at 350 for 30 minutes.
